#f0b644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0b644 is composed of 94.1% red, 71.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#f0b644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#e16d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f0b644 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0b644 has RGB values of R:240, G:182,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.72,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15775300.

Shades and Tints of #f0b644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0b644
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9a99 is the less saturated color, while #f8b93c is the most saturated one.
